Business grad beats the odds with tenacity, generosity鈥攁nd big plans

June 7, 2017 - The Ring

Siyad Jama's journey to a BCom degree at UVic's Gustavson School of Business began when he stepped off the plane in Victoria for the first time in 2011. "I had no idea what to expect," he recalls. "It was all new to me鈥擟anada, Victoria, UVic. I knew it was the warmest place in Canada, but coming from Kenya, even that meant something different."

Zwiers joins ranks of world's highly cited researchers

November 21, 2016 - The Ring

It鈥檚 always gratifying to have data-driven, third party recognition of UVic's global research impact. Thomson Reuters' 2016 list of the world鈥檚 most highly cited researchers includes climate statistician Francis Zwiers, of the Pacific Climate Impacts Consortium, as well as two previously recognized researchers: mechanical engineer Yang Shi and business professor Roy Suddaby.

Intercultural collaborations forge first business PhD

June 3, 2016 - The Ring

鈥淚鈥檝e always been fascinated by how people work across differences,鈥 says Sarah Easter, the Sardul S. Gill Graduate School鈥檚 first PhD alumna. Her recently-defended dissertation stands as testament to this passion: her work explores (among other things) which traits allow individuals to successfully collaborate, despite culturally-based differences. The Greater Victoria Coalition to End Homelessness鈥攃omprised of over forty organizations and associations from different sectors鈥攑rovided the perfect case study for her to research these individuals in action.
